Skip to content

Commit

Permalink
更新v0.28,新增叠层监视、冻结AE,AE赋予增加冲突检查,中了EMP不扭炮塔,礼盒血量可写数字
Browse files Browse the repository at this point in the history
  • Loading branch information
ChrisLv-CN committed Dec 7, 2022
1 parent b0ad034 commit db95c72
Show file tree
Hide file tree
Showing 35 changed files with 24 additions and 0 deletions.
24 changes: 24 additions & 0 deletions DynamicPatcher/Kratos食用说明书.ini
Original file line number Diff line number Diff line change
Expand Up @@ -687,6 +687,7 @@ Group=-1 ;分组,同一个分组的效果互相影响,削减或增加持续
OverrideSameGroup=no ;同一个分组已存在,再赋予则覆盖
Next=StandTest1 ;AE结束后进入下一个AE
; 附加方式精确控制
AttachWithOutTypes=AE1,AE2 ;身上有这些AE,则不可赋予
AttachOnceInTechnoType=no ;用于出厂附加时,只在单位生成时附加一次,不会在Delay后重新获得
Inheritable=yes ;当使用GiftBox变身并且InheritAE的时候,该AE是否可以被继承,带有GiftBox的AE强制无法继承
; 赋予对象过滤器专属设置
Expand Down Expand Up @@ -720,6 +721,12 @@ Status.ArmorMultiplier=1.0 ;防御系数,Stand.IsVirtualTurret=yes时,替身
Status.SpeedMultiplier=1.0 ;速度系数,替身身上的Status模块AE无效,替身不会动
Status.ROFMultiplier=1.0 ;冷却时间(射速)系数,单位开火后会进入ROF帧不能攻击的状态,缩短ROF相当于提高射速,Stand.IsVirtualTurret=yes时,替身身上的Status模块AE无效,会同步使者的属性
Status.Cloakable=no ;隐形,替身身上的Status模块AE无效,替身与使者强制同步
; 模块:叠加 —— AE生效期间,监视某个AE的叠加层数达到指定层数,为持有者添加新的AE,被超时空冻结时仍然有效
Stack.Watch=AE1 ;待监视的AE
Stack.Level=0 ;监视的AE叠加到多少层时触发
Stack.AttachEffects=AE1,AE2 ;触发后赋予的新AE
Stack.TriggeredTimes=-1 ;触发多少次后移除自身
Stack.RemoveAll=yes ;触发后移除监视的所有AE
; 模块:替身 —— AE生效期间,为附着对象添加一个独立单位做替身,替身会始终跟随使者行动
Stand.Type=APOC ;替身类型,可以是虚拟单位
Stand.Offset=0,0,0 ;替身的位置,单位的FLH,+F在建筑的右下方,
Expand Down Expand Up @@ -939,6 +946,8 @@ GiftBox.AffectWho=MASTER ;作用于谁,ALL\MASTER\STAND
; 特殊设定,单位转换,继承血量、目标、编队和任务
GiftBox.IsTransform=no ;是否使用单位转换机制,启用后,礼盒将会强制删除,并不会发生爆炸
GiftBox.HealthPercent=100% ;指定礼物的血量百分比,0-1,0或者0%,按照原单位血量百分比进行转换
GiftBox.HealthNumber=0 ;直接指定礼物的血量数字,低于1,不使用
GiftBox.InheritHealthNumber=no ;指定礼物是否继承原单位的血量数字,非按比例转换
GiftBox.InheritTarget=yes ;指定礼物是否继承原单位的目标
GiftBox.InheritExp=yes ;如果可以升级则继承等级
GiftBox.InheritAmmo=no ;如果有弹药则继承弹药,没有弹药生成有弹药,弹药箱清空
Expand Down Expand Up @@ -972,6 +981,9 @@ FireSuperWeapon.DeactiveWhenCivilian=no ;启用时,当所属是平民时,或
; 模块:禁止选择, 状态类型 —— AE生效期间,附着的单位无法被选择,无法对抛射体生效
Select.Disable=no ;启用时无法被选中,但是可以
Select.AffectWho=ALL ;作用于谁,ALL\MASTER\STAND
; 模块:停止运动, 状态类型 —— AE生效期间,单位无法行动,硬在原地,像中了EMP一样
Freeze.Enable=no ;启用失活状态
Freeze.AffectWho=ALL ;作用于谁,ALL\MASTER\STAND
; 模块:嘲讽(攻击信标), 状态类型 —— AE生效期间,吸引指定范围内的指定对象攻击自己
AttackBeacon.Enable=yes ;开启炒粉光环
AttackBeacon.Types=V3,DRED ;炒粉谁,不写则是全部类型
Expand Down Expand Up @@ -1001,6 +1013,8 @@ DamageReaction.Delay=0 ;成功触发一次之后到下一次允许触发的延
DamageReaction.ActiveOnce=no ;触发之后在当前帧结束后结束效果
DamageReaction.TriggeredTimes=-1 ;可触发的次数,次数用完立刻强制结束效果
DamageReaction.ResetTriggeredTimes=no ;当单位从精英变成新兵时重置计数器
DamageReaction.TriggeredAttachEffects=AE1,AE2 ;触发响应时为自己添加AE
DamageReaction.TriggeredAttachEffectsFromAttacker=no ;触发响应时为自己添加的AE来源是攻击者
DamageReaction.Anim=NONE ;触发伤害响应的动画
DamageReaction.AnimFLH=0,0,0 ;触发伤害响应的动画位置
DamageReaction.AnimDelay=0 ;播放一次动画后到下一次允许播放的延迟
Expand Down Expand Up @@ -1231,4 +1245,14 @@ Capturer=no
Teleporter=no


; 不触发伤害响应弹头
[WarheadType]
IgnoreDamageReaction=no


; 忽略替身分享伤害
[WarheadType]
IgnoreStandShareDamage=no



Binary file modified DynamicPatcher/Libraries/Extension.Kratos.dll
Binary file not shown.
Binary file modified DynamicPatcher/Libraries/Extension.Kratos.pdb
Binary file not shown.
Binary file modified DynamicPatcher/Packages/Build/ComponentHooks/AnimComponent.pkg
Binary file not shown.
Binary file modified DynamicPatcher/Packages/Build/ComponentHooks/BulletComponent.pkg
Binary file not shown.
Binary file not shown.
Binary file modified DynamicPatcher/Packages/Build/ComponentHooks/TechnoComponent.pkg
Binary file not shown.
Binary file modified DynamicPatcher/Packages/Build/ExtensionHooks/AnimExt.pkg
Binary file not shown.
Binary file modified DynamicPatcher/Packages/Build/ExtensionHooks/AnimTypeExt.pkg
Binary file not shown.
Binary file modified DynamicPatcher/Packages/Build/ExtensionHooks/BulletExt.pkg
Binary file not shown.
Binary file modified DynamicPatcher/Packages/Build/ExtensionHooks/BulletTypeExt.pkg
Binary file not shown.
Binary file modified DynamicPatcher/Packages/Build/ExtensionHooks/CellExt.pkg
Binary file not shown.
Binary file modified DynamicPatcher/Packages/Build/ExtensionHooks/EBoltExt.pkg
Binary file not shown.
Binary file modified DynamicPatcher/Packages/Build/ExtensionHooks/HouseExt.pkg
Binary file not shown.
Binary file modified DynamicPatcher/Packages/Build/ExtensionHooks/HouseTypeExt.pkg
Binary file not shown.
Binary file modified DynamicPatcher/Packages/Build/ExtensionHooks/LaserDrawExt.pkg
Binary file not shown.
Binary file modified DynamicPatcher/Packages/Build/ExtensionHooks/MapExt.pkg
Binary file not shown.
Binary file modified DynamicPatcher/Packages/Build/ExtensionHooks/ParasiteExt.pkg
Binary file not shown.
Binary file modified DynamicPatcher/Packages/Build/ExtensionHooks/SpawnManagerExt.pkg
Binary file not shown.
Binary file modified DynamicPatcher/Packages/Build/ExtensionHooks/SuperWeaponExt.pkg
Binary file not shown.
Binary file not shown.
Binary file modified DynamicPatcher/Packages/Build/ExtensionHooks/TechnoExt.pkg
Binary file not shown.
Binary file modified DynamicPatcher/Packages/Build/ExtensionHooks/TechnoTypeExt.pkg
Binary file not shown.
Binary file modified DynamicPatcher/Packages/Build/ExtensionHooks/TerrainExt.pkg
Binary file not shown.
Binary file modified DynamicPatcher/Packages/Build/ExtensionHooks/WarheadTypeExt.pkg
Binary file not shown.
Binary file modified DynamicPatcher/Packages/Build/ExtensionHooks/WeaponTypeExt.pkg
Binary file not shown.
Binary file modified DynamicPatcher/Packages/Build/GeneralHooks/GScreenExt.pkg
Binary file not shown.
Binary file modified DynamicPatcher/Packages/Build/GeneralHooks/General.pkg
Binary file not shown.
Binary file modified DynamicPatcher/Packages/Build/GeneralHooks/PointerExpire.pkg
Binary file not shown.
Binary file modified DynamicPatcher/Packages/Build/GeneralHooks/Savegame.pkg
Binary file not shown.
Binary file modified DynamicPatcher/Packages/Build/Miscellaneous/DynamicLoadINI.pkg
Binary file not shown.
Binary file modified DynamicPatcher/Packages/Build/Miscellaneous/DynamicScript.pkg
Binary file not shown.
Binary file modified DynamicPatcher/Packages/Build/Miscellaneous/Preprocess.pkg
Binary file not shown.
Binary file modified DynamicPatcher/Packages/Build/Miscellaneous/SurfaceDisplayer.pkg
Binary file not shown.
Binary file modified DynamicPatcher/Packages/Build/Scripts/ParaScript.pkg
Binary file not shown.

0 comments on commit db95c72

Please sign in to comment.